Property Report
This property, located at 29a, Northfield Road, N16 5RL in London, is a flat that was built between 1900-1929. The property has a floor area of 71 square meters and is described as fully double-glazed. In terms of energy efficiency, the property has a current energy rating of D and a potential energy rating of C. The main heating system is a boiler and radiators, powered by mains gas. The property has a current energy consumption of 248 units per year and a potential energy consumption of 171 units per year. The running costs are £917 per year, while the energy costs saving is estimated to be £702 per year. - Based on our analysis, this property has a HomeScore of 849 out of 999.
